表格中的配置设置

设置

描述

属性

FontFactory

这是您添加字体的主要字体工厂。

Mode设置文件,然后使用该文件工厂,或者删除Windows GDI factory的属性。

AddFolder

从指定文件中添加所有TrueType字体。

Path指定绝对路径到文件。

VirtualPath指定虚拟路径到文件夹。

Substitute

设置一个可以替换官方字体名称的名字。

Font简短的字体名称。

To:官方字体名称。

SetFallbackFont(仅限专业版)

在以下情况下,在专业版中设置字体:

a)     指定字体未安装。

b)    未指定或未安装替代字体

c)     未设置字体连接,或者在AddFontLink设置中找不到所需的字形。

Font字体名称

AddFontLink(仅限专业版)

在专业版中,特别支持中日韩字形,您可以添加字体连接,它会允许PdfExport在其他字体列表中查找从指定字体中缺失的任何字形。

Font在报表中使用的字体。

List在找不到字体字形的情况下要使用以逗号分隔开的字体列表。

如果在AddFolder设置的指定文件夹中可替换的字体文件不存在,那么连接的字符。

IsDefault:设置为True,则可以使用列表中的任何字体。这些字体没有属于自己的字体连接。

 

注:以下是字体的搜索顺序

1.     控件中指定的字体。

2.     替代设置中的映射指定字体。

3.     AddFontLink设置中指定的字体。

4.     SetFallbackFont设置中指定的字体。

注:对于Azure项目中,在项目字体文件中给所有字体设置属性的方法如下:

1.   设置设置复制到输出目录并且始终复制。

2.   设置BuildAction到Content